The Successful Gamble that Paid Off for Gambling.com’s Founder

Reading Time: < 1 minute

Charles Gillespie, the founder and CEO of Gambling.com Group, took a big gamble that paid off in a big way. Starting his entrepreneurial journey with a risky bet, Gillespie now leads the world’s leading online gambling affiliate network with over 50 media sites under its belt.

Describing his decision as “almost beautifully stupid,” Gillespie’s risk-taking attitude has led to tremendous success. Gambling.com Group operates as a performance marketing company, driving high-value traffic to its clients in the online gambling industry. Gillespie emphasizes the importance of connecting customers to the best options that fit their needs, much like hotels.com does for accommodations.

Before diving into the online gambling world, Gillespie was a skilled online poker player, using his expertise to build his first affiliate site in 2003. Despite facing challenges with US regulations, Gillespie persevered and eventually found success in the UK market. When the US legalized online gambling in 2018, Gillespie pivoted his focus back to his home country, leading to significant revenue growth.

Today, Gambling.com Group generates $108 million in total revenue, with the US market accounting for $60 million. Gillespie’s journey from a college dorm room to a publicly traded company in the online gambling industry serves as a testament to the power of taking risks and betting on oneself.

Reflecting on his entrepreneurial journey, Gillespie acknowledges the naivety and recklessness of some of his early decisions but emphasizes the valuable lesson he learned: the best bet you can make is one on yourself.
